I download the "Philips HTS3455 Home Theater" and "Philips_HTS3544_ipod_dock upgrade". The upgrade did nothing but i did get one button from the home theater to work. The AUX/DI button changed my input to aux. I then tried the "Philips Tuner" from that section and now i have partial functionality.
I then went back into the upgrade and changed the device 1 to 17 and device 2 to 16 leaving device 3 blank and that gave me partial functionality.
Protocol RC-5
Device1: 17
Device2: 16
Device3: 0
Gives me channel up/down power off mute radio input

Protocol RC-5
Device1: 17
Device2: 16
Device3: (blank) says 240 next to the box
Gives me channel up/down volume up/down power on

Normally i would just upload both and do key moves but i don't have enough room left for the key moves. Any suggestions on an easy way to search for the missing functions? Also the "Philips_HTS3544_ipod_dock upgrade" is the first one i have encountered with the byte 2: dev# in yellow. An explanation or a link to an explanation would be much appreciated.

Leaving dev3 blank simply means that the number entered into dev2 gets used instead, but when you enter 0 that's what gets used.

For us to make sense of your results, you would need to tell us which buttons worked in each case, and are you really saying that when you changed the dev3 setting, some buttons stopped working and others started working? That would be a very interesting result given that none of the buttons in this upgrade actually use dev3.
